Secondary processes: this intermediary level of brain organization mediates understanding and memory, and is effectively studied in each animals and humans. The actual mechanisms of studying and memory have been largely clarified via animal analysis. Major processes: these deeply subcortical functions, homologous presumably in all mammals, constitute the primary affective processes which contain sensory impacts (e.g taste, touch, and pain), bodily homeostatic impacts (e.g NS018 hydrochloride hunger and thirst) and emotional affects (see Box 2), that are most important for understanding empathy. These brain functions are most clearly analyzed and understood through crossspecies mammalian research, which is largely inaccessible to routine human experimentation. This foundational level is of important value for understanding the larger brain functions [23,32,48].Trends Neurosci.
